以太坊NFT铸造步骤是什么?如何选择ERC-721与ERC-1155?

欧易OKX
欧易OKX
简介: 欧易OKX是全球知名的数字货币交易平台,提供安全、多样化的交易服务和创新金融产品,满足不同用户需求。

在以太坊区块链上,铸造NFT (非同质化代币) 的过程承载着创作者的梦想与创意。流程虽然看似简单,但却涉及多个关键环节,包括准备数字资产、选择标准(ERC-721或ERC-1155)、部署智能合约、上传元数据以及支付手续费。为了确保这些独特的数字资产能够高效且安全地发行,掌握每个步骤至关重要。本文将深入探讨以太坊NFT铸造过程中的关键环节,帮助创作者了解如何有效运用ERC-721和ERC-1155标准,选择适合的解决方案,推动其项目成功。

1

想象NFT诞生的秘密工厂:铸造流程揭密

要在以太坊上铸造NFT,首先需要准备好数字艺术或媒体文件,例如图像、音频或视频,同时确保拥有这些文件的版权。需要特别强调的是,这些媒体本身并不是NFT,而NFT则是一串在区块链上记录的代币,其元数据(如链接、描述)指向这些数字文件。接下来,用户需要选择一个兼容以太坊的钱包(如MetaMask),并确保其中储备足够的以太币,以便支付交易手续费。

之后,用户可以选择一个支持铸造的NFT市场平台,或者选择自行部署智能合约。众多市场平台都提供简便的铸造流程,而技术团队可以采用ERC-721或ERC-1155的模板,根据项目需求进行合约的部署。具体来说,ERC-721适合于独立的项目铸造,而ERC-1155则能够在一个合约中同时管理多件资产,特别有利于批量操作和管理。完成合约的部署后,通过调用合约函数(如ERC-721中的tokenURI或ERC-1155的uri)设置代币ID和元数据URI,最终完成NFT的铸造。

唤醒“独一无二”:ERC-721 的魅力与限度

ERC-721标准是第一个正式定义NFT的标准,于2018年问世,开启了数字收藏品市场的新时代。它确保每个NFT都拥有唯一的标识符(tokenId),非常适合代表艺术作品、收藏品或虚拟地产等个性化资产。ERC-721的设计支持追踪所有权、转移权属以及查询总供应等功能,这使得它能够很好地满足大多数钱包和平台的兼容性需求。

不过,值得注意的是,ERC-721的每个NFT通常涉及单独的交易,这使得在一次铸造或转移多个NFT时,交易数量和手续费可能会成倍增加,尤其在网络拥堵时更为明显。此外,每种NFT类型可能需要不同的合约,这进一步增加了合约部署与管理的成本。因此,尽管ERC-721非常适合表达每件作品的独特性,但在面临批量或复杂资产场景时,它的表现可能略显不足。

批量神奇管家:为什么选择 ERC‑1155?

ERC-1155标准由Enjin团队提出,其设计初衷是为了改善游戏资产管理的痛点。其核心亮点在于它能够在一个合约中同时管理多种类型的资产,包括可替代代币、非同质化代币和半可替代代币。这种灵活性适用于需要同时处理道具、货币、资源与收藏等复合场景的情况。

ERC-1155支持批量传输(batch transfers),这意味着用户可以通过一次交易转移多个代币,显著降低交易数量和手续费,并减轻链上的压力。此外,它还具备安全回退机制,比如当接收方不支持该标准时,资产能自动退回,避免资产丢失的风险。这种机制提升了ERC-1155的实用性,使其在游戏、市场或需要组合操作的NFT项目中具有更大的优势。

当合约背后都在“说话”:ERC‑721 与 ERC‑1155 的生态表现

历史上,ERC-721被广泛采用,在许多NFT市场中享有良好的兼容性,也让用户习惯于其操作方式。诸如CryptoKitties和CryptoPunks等先驱项目大多数基于该标准。然而,随着NFT的应用场景逐步扩展,特别是在游戏和复杂资产场景中,ERC-1155的效率与灵活性日益吸引关注。

目前,主流平台对ERC-1155的支持正在增加,虽然尚未完全普及,但在游戏道具、道具组合和领域市场等方向,ERC-1155已经展现出了其价值。对于开发者来说,可以根据目标资产的结构与市场定位来选择合适的标准,有些项目甚至结合采用这两种标准,比如使用ERC-1155存储可批量处理道具,同时用ERC-721处理独一性收藏品,从而兼顾效率与独特性。

现实考量:成本与战略决策之间如何平衡?

铸造NFT所涉及的成本主要体现在以太坊的交易手续费(gas)上。当网络拥堵时,每笔交易的费用可能会高达几十美元,因此批量铸造显得尤为重要,能够为用户带来显著的成本节省。使用ERC-1155的批量功能可以减少交易次数,从而降低gas负担。反之,如果选择ERC-721进行多个NFT的铸造,将会导致手续费激增,这一点在大规模发行项目中更为明显。

除了交易手续费外,某些平台可能还会收取上架费和交易佣金,这都成为整体成本结构的一部分。对于偏重创意的单件艺术品创作者而言,费用可能在可接受范围之内;但若项目规模较大或涉及用户共同拥有的资产,就需要优先考虑效率与成本之间的平衡。建议在制定策略时,首先明确项目需求,是强调个性化与收藏价值,还是追求游戏体验或大批量交易,这将有助于更好地评估选择的标准与相关成本。

总结:选择有底气,也要关注风险

总之,在以太坊上铸造NFT是一个结构明晰但涉及多个环节的复杂流程。ERC-721以其清晰和独立的特性非常适合表达每件作品的身份,而ERC-1155则在处理多个资产和批量操作时提供了更高的效率与灵活性。做出选择时,应基于项目目标、成本结构及用户体验进行判断,同时考虑平台的支持情况和智能合约的安全性能。

尽管这些标准和流程有助于NFT项目的推广和服务用户,但也潜藏着一定的风险。例如,以太坊的gas费用波动可能导致费用飙升;如果智能合约未经过充分审计,可能出现安全漏洞。尽管ERC-1155的回退机制能减少资产丢失,若使用不当也有可能引发错误操作的风险。因此,在部署之前,建议用户充分测试与验证,确保智能合约的安全性,同时关注平台的支持情况,并适当控制发行规模或分批推出,以降低意外风险,稳步推动项目的发展。

币安
币安
简介: 币安(Binance)是一家全球领先的加密货币交易平台,提供安全、多样化的交易服务,并支持众多数字资产。